A great presentation for both new graduates and experienced clinicians alike, this live lecture is aimed at improving understanding of managing complex workers’ compensation claims, specifically within the Queensland context. Delivered at both a WorkCover Queensland and physiotherapist level, this lecture will provide insights into WorkCover and a complex case study.

 

Presenters

Thomas McMillan, FACP, is a Specialist Musculoskeletal Physiotherapist with clinical, governance and management roles across the healthcare spectrum. He is the Executive Director of the Physio Plus Group which provides multidisciplinary allied health services in private practices, private hospitals, disability, aged care, industry and elite sport in two Australian states. He is also the President of the Australian College of Physiotherapists, Member WorkCover Queensland Medical Allied Health Panel, and is an Adjunct Associate Professor at James Cook University's College of Healthcare Sciences. He has previously sat on the Board of the Mackay Hospital and Health Service and the Council of the National Rural Health Alliance. Tom is also a previous Clinical Lead for the Australian Digital Health Agency.

 

Matthew Bannan is a registered physiotherapist and has over 18 years' experience at WorkCover providing exceptional customer experience and delivering successful outcomes for workers and employers through best practice claims and injury management principles. He leads a team with a collective purpose of creating trusted stakeholder engagement and partnership activities across WorkCover's ecosystem including First Nations communities, medical, hospital and allied health providers.
